It is important to support Oakland's many needs throughout the city, and one of the ways we can build a stronger future is by expanding development that generates housing, jobs, business opportunity, social equity, and expands tax revenue.
The City Council has affirmed and designated the Black Arts Movement and Business District (BAMBD) to provide for recognition and revitalization efforts in this area. This is a project of citywide significance.
The types of facilities proposed to be transformed include those that will support and strengthen the BAMBD. They include: a series of public streetscape improvements, public banners along Oakland's Fourteenth Street corridor, tenant improvements, facade improvements, and accessibility improvements.
